In a word perception experiment, the amount of sentence context was varied (0, 4, or 8 words).As the amount of context increased, the probability of perceptual recognition of the final target word also increased.Explain whether or not this reflects conceptually driven or data-driven pattern recognition.

This pattern of increasing probability of perceptual recognition as the amount of sentence context increases reflects conceptually driven pattern recognition. Conceptually driven pattern recognition occurs when prior knowledge, expectations, and context influence the perception and recognition of stimuli. In this experiment, the increase in sentence context provides more information and cues for the participants to use in recognizing the final target word. As they have more context to draw from, they can use their conceptual understanding of language and the meaning of the sentence to aid in recognizing the target word. This is in contrast to data-driven pattern recognition, which relies solely on the features and characteristics of the stimuli themselves. Therefore, the increase in perceptual recognition with more sentence context suggests that conceptual knowledge and expectations play a significant role in the recognition process.
